Rapportage MKG5 - Xtrareports

Nieuw rapport maken

Ga naar het menu van Rapportage.

 

Een nieuw rapport maken kan op vier manieren:

  1. Userrapport maken van Standaard rapport
    • Sjabloon rapporten – Document: Standaardrapporten (9019)
  1. Rapport importeren

 

  1. Leeg rapport openen

 

  1. Rapport kopiëren

 

Userrapport maken van Standaard rapport

Stap 1: Open de module Standaard rapporten

 

Stap 2: Selecteer een rapport

Stap 3: Klik op Maak user rapport

 

Rapport kopiëren

Stap 1: Open de module Standaard rapporten

 

 

 

 

 

 

 

 

 

Sjabloon rapporten

Stap 1: Open Standaard rapporten
Stap 2:  Maak userrapport
Stap 3:  Open User rapporten
Stap 4:  Pas Document en omschrijving van rapport aan
•Document: De tabel waar het rapport op gebaseerd wordt. 

 

 

Rapport importeren – 1/2

Stap 1: Open User rapporten
Stap 2:  Klik op Importeren

 

Stap 3:  Selecteer xml om te importeren


Klik op Importeren

 

Rapport importeren – 2/2

• Bestand – Kies een xml welke je wilt importeren
• Proces – Wordt automatisch gevuld
• Nieuw/ Bestaand rapport – Wil je een nieuw rapport inlezen of een bestaande vervangen
•(Bestaand rapport) – Welk bestaand rapport wil je vervangen
• Omschrijving – Wordt automatisch gevuld, kan aangepast worden.

 

Leeg rapport

1. Open User rapporten
2. Klik op nieuw knop (User rapport)
3. Geef een document op
4. Geef een rapportnummer op

 

5. Geef een omschrijving op

 

Rapport ontwerper openen

• Rapport ontwerper kan alleen geopend worden bij User rapporten


Rapport ontwerper openen

User rapporten

Werkbalken


Werkbalken      

 

 

Gereedschap

• Objecten die op het rapport geplaatst kunnen worden
 


Gereedschap

 

Rapport-verkenner

•Toont alle objecten op het rapport
•Detail rapporten
•Velden
 

Rapport-verkenner

 

 

Veldenlijst

•Velden
•Verzamelingen
 

Veldenlijst

 

 

Eigenschappen

•Eigenschappen van geselecteerd object

 


Eigenschappen

 

 

 

 

Standaard aanpassingen in Sjabloonrapport

• Administratienaam
• Administratie > Bedrijfsnaam
• Samenvatting samengestelde gegevens
• Administratie > Samenvatting aangemelde gegevens
• Bedrijfslogo

 

• Administratie > Bedrijfslogo
 
 

 

 

Gegevenslid

•Geef de tabel in welke gekoppeld moet worden aan de DetailBand
 


Gegevenslid

 

 

 

 

 

Type rapport

•Type = 0 Rapport op basis van 1 record
• Opdrachtbevestiging, pakbon, factuur etc..
• Type = 1 Rapport op basis van alle records
• Overzichtsrapporten, vooral gebruikt in mijn bedrijf
• Ingeven bij Markering(Tag)
 


Type rapport

 

 

Rapport instellingen 2

• Meeteenheden – Tienden van een millimeter
• Dit is bij een leeg rapport ingesteld op Tienden van een inch
• Scripttaal – Gebruikte taal voor scripts
• Weergavenaam – Getoonde naam linksboven
• Geen klantnaam gebruiken hier
 


Rapport instellingen 2

 

 

Rapport instellingen 3

•Pagina instellingen

 

•Papiertype is bij een leeg rapport niet ingesteld op A4
 


Pagina instellingen

 

Veld eigenschappen (grootte)

• Klik op veld in veldenlijst en sleep naar plek op rapport

 

Velden toevoegen

• Geef veld de juiste hoogte (35/40 tienden van een mm)
• Eigenschappen > Grootte
• 40 voor externe rapporten
• 35 voor overzichtsrapporten

 


Veld eigenschappen

 

 

Veld eigenschappen (inspringing)

• Inspringing/marges

 

• Alles op 0
 


Veld eigenschappen (inspringing)

 

 

Veld opmaak 1

• Selecteer veld
• Klik op pijltje rechtsboven
• Klik op 3 puntjes bij opmaakmasker
• Selecteer opmaak

 

• Of geef meteen een opmaak in
 


Veld opmaak 1


Veld opmaak 2

•Veel gebruikte opmaken
•Datum: {0:dd-MM-yy}
•Getal zonder decimaal {0:n0}
• Getal met 2 decimalen {0:n2}
• Bedrag {0:c2} à Geeft altijd €

 

• Prefix: xxxxx {0} à Voorbeeld: Totaal: {0}
 
 

 

Sortering

•Groeperen en Sorteren
• Sortering toevoegen
• Veld kiezen om op te sorteren (LET OP: dit veld moet aanwezig zijn op het rapport)
 


Sortering


 

Groepering

• Groeperen en sorteren
•Idem als sortering
• Toon kop wordt nu automatisch aangevinkt

 

• Naar boven/Naar beneden > Volgorde van groepering/sortering
 

 

Samenvatting

•Samenvatting kan in kop en voet geplaatst worden
•Sleep/kopieer veld naar kop of voet

•Klik op pijltje rechtsboven rapport
•Samenvatting 
•Totaal-functie
•Opmaak masker (moet voor groep opnieuw ingesteld worden)
•Samenvatting lopend
 

 

Detailrapport invoegen (gekoppeld)

•Rechtermuisknop op detailband (Relaties)
•Detailrapport invoegen

 

•Selecteer tabel/verzameling (Debiteuren)


Detailrapport invoegen (gekoppeld)


Detailrapport invoegen (niet gekoppeld)

• Rechtermuisknop op detailband (Relaties)
• Detailrapport invoegen
• Niet gekoppeld
• Klik op pijltje bij DetailReport

 

• Selecteer alsnog tabel/verzameling, je kunt nu ook een tabel van een onderliggend niveau selecteren (Debiteuren > Verkooporders)

 

Veld toevoegen uit gekoppelde tabel

•Voorbeeld Relatie > Agent > Naam

 

 

•Selecteer in tabel Relaties de tabel Agent en vervolgens Naam

 


Veld toevoegen uit gekoppelde tabel

 

 

Veld toevoegen uit gekoppelde tabel

• Onderdrukking
• Achtergrondkleur
• Voorgrond kleur
• Lettertype


Opmaak regels – Editor openen



Opmaak regels – Editor openen



Opmaak regels – Onderdrukking

• Voorbeeld: Relatie niet tonen als het geen debiteur is
• Veld Is debiteur toevoegen aan rapport
• Nieuwe opmaakregel aanmaken
• Naam
• Gegevenslid > Tabel waarop opmaak regel van toepassing is > Relaties
• [is debiteur (t_debi)] != True
• Voorwaarde > Voorwaarde waarbij opmaakregel van toepassing is
• Opmaken
• Visible = Nee



Opmaak regels - Toepassen

• Selecteer veld of band waarop de opmaak regel toegepast moet worden
• Klik op pijltje
• Opmaakregels
• Verschuif opmaakregel naar de rechter kolom



Gecalculeerde kolom

•Voorbeeld: Agent + Naam, leeg als Agent niet gevuld is
•Rechtermuisknop op tabel relatie
•Voeg berekend veld toe
•Weergavenaam
•Expressie
•Iif([Agent (agtn_num)] == 0, '' ,[Agent (agtn_num)]+' - '+[Agent (_agtn_num-1).Naam (agtn_naam)] )